We provide IT Staff Augmentation Services!

Director Of Technology & Solution; Lead Solution Architect Resume

2.00/5 (Submit Your Rating)

Reston, VA

SUMMARY:

Full - time, permanent Enterprise/Senior Hands-On Director/Architect/Manager: Architect, design, develop and manage development of solutions to complex business problems using my expertise in SOA, J2EE, ERP, Database and EAI & B2B technologies and my experience in leading design and development of software systems

PROFESSIONAL EXPERIENCE:

Confidential, Reston, VA

Director of Technology & Solution; Lead Solution Architect

Responsibilities:

  • Lead and manage 8 onshore solution architects and 25 offshore developers
  • Lead and manage solution implementation for more than 10 carriers and 47 states
  • Facing carriers and states to understand requirements and conduct gap analysis
  • Design effective solutions and ensure they fit within the enterprise context
  • Lead development of formalized solution methodologies
  • Interface and coordinate tasks with internal and external technical resources
  • Collaborates with Project Managers to provision estimates, develop overall implementation solution plan, serve as a lead, to implement the installation, customization, and integration efforts
  • Provide end to end solution and design details
  • Oversee aspects of project life cycle, from initial kickoff through requirements analysis, design and implementation phases for projects within the solution area
  • Conduct demos to carriers and resolve issues
  • Provide quality assurance for services within the solution area
  • Mentor and guide junior to senior technical resources
  • Recruiting new resources
  • Full life cycle solution implementation (Configure + Customize) on WEM (WebInsure Exchange Manager) using Cloud Computing, FireHost, Web Service, SOA, Adeptia BPM & ESB, Oracle 11g R2, Apache, TomcatSpring, JPA, Hibernate, ehCache, jQuery, iText, Apache POI, Jasper BI, Drools, slf4j/logback, Splunk, MavenUbuntu, RHEL, Socketlabs, Apache CAS, TIBCO Foresight Instream, TIBCO EDISIM, JDK 7, VPN, etc.

Confidential, Reston, VA

Sr. Manager & Sr. Systems/Solution Architect

Responsibilities:

  • Architect highly complex, global solutions across the appropriate engineering environments to meet business requirements or enhance performance
  • Lead extended IT team including consultants
  • Recommend vendor/approach and present to senior management
  • Plans, conducts and oversees the technical aspects of large, complex projects
  • Coordinate the efforts of technical staff in the performance of assigned projects
  • Review completion and implementation of system additions and/or enhancements and provide management overviews
  • Develop and apply advanced methods, theories and research techniques in the investigation and solution of highly complex system requirements and problems
  • Review literature and current practices to support business requirements and/or new industry technology
  • Prepare reports and/or recommendations regarding new technology to appropriate personnel
  • Provide leadership and work guidance to various technical personnel from senior to junior levels
  • Work closely with business teams and other technical teams to analyze and understand business requirements, participate and lead technical solution architecture
  • Lead the architecture, design, development, and implementation of SOA - based applications.
  • Lead, coach and facilitate team members in SOA development
  • Lead to estimate and plan software development tasks in a Scrum environment
  • Provide daily supervision and direction to team members
  • Worked side by side with CTO on ESS/MSS (Employee/Manager Self Service) for 5 years
  • Full life cycle software development on ESS (Employee Self Service) product using Web Service, SOA, BPEL,GWTNetweaver, Oracle 10g, Java, J2EE, Java Servlets, JSP, XML, Struts, Hibernate, JPA, MS SQLServer, DeltekTomcat, JUnit, Drools, #LF Ant, CVS, Tortoise CVS, Enterprise Architect, Viso, Log4j,Araxis Merge,MyEclipseJDeveloper,Flex3,ActionScript 3, BlazeDS, JavaMail, etc.
  • Establish the overall SOA Architecture/Infrastructure for various business processes
  • Establish the overall technology stack for full life cycle software development
  • Define the software development methodology for Confidential development team
  • Lead and Manage the ESS team for the full life cycle software development using Agile/SCRUM
  • Lead to create the release plan to deliver the ESS new features and improvements
  • Manage project deliverables, quality, schedule and cost.
  • Architect, Design and develop the ESS core services Transaction monitor Worklist Notification Message Rules Email Approval
  • Architect, Design and Develop the following business processes (BPEL) Employee Termination International and National Purchasing - Purchase Requisitions Travel Request
  • Employee On-Boarding Expenses Personnel status change (PSC)
  • Employee Directory #L F Vendor Management AP for Expense Report
  • Accounts Payable Document management Benefits Data capture for benefits selection
  • Invoice processing and setup
  • Lead the design and development on the data modeling
  • Lead the design and development on the web services (JAX-WS) layer
  • Design and develop the persistence layer using Spring, JPA, Hibernate 3 with annotation
  • Design and develop the Company Organizational Breakdown Structure (OBS) and employee basic information in Active Directory.
  • Architect and design the Notification and Approval Process
  • Research and evaluate various SOA products including Oracle, BEA, ServiceMix, etc.
  • Design and develop screens in the presentation layer using Struts
  • Configure rules service using Drools and message templates
  • Lead to migrate ESS data from SQL server to Oracle
  • Architect, Design and Develop ESS refactoring to handle multiple data sources from different companies
  • Team up with the business analysts to review the requirements on the business processes
  • Fully automate the weekly large reports generation process for DataBank: report generation, FTP transfer via Java API, email notification, scheduling, password encryption, etc.
  • Mobile access to MSS for managers to approve the Finance Transactions.
  • Mentor mid- to senior-level developers and provide the technical solutions to their tough issues
  • Create various templates for technical documents
  • Assist CTO to select and standardize the design and development tools, etc.
  • Conducted recruiting new hires
  • Manage and conduct various team building activities
  • Full life cycle software development on Timesheet and Project management using Web Service, Spring, Hibernate with annotations, CAMeLEAN, Deltek CostPoint, Oracle 10g, JDeveloper, MyEclipse, MS #LF SQL Server, etc.
  • Project planning services
  • Project monitoring
  • Timesheet upload and download services
  • Time Correction services
  • Expense downloading services
  • Full life cycle software development on Organization Breakdown Structure (OBS) using Spring, Spring-LDAPHibernate with annotations, Active Directory, Deltek CostPoint, Oracle 10g, MyEclipse, MS SQL ServerOracle DB 9i, JMS, etc.
  • Designed the framework to manage the OBS to meet the requirement of frequent company acquisitions
  • Developed the backend Java APIs using Spring, Spring-LDAP, Hibernate with annotations and JMS.
  • Reviewed the design of OBS Browser and OBS Builder UI.
  • Full life cycle software development on the new ESS (Employee Self Service) to support multiple data source instances at same point of time
  • Created the new architecture of ESS to support multiple data sources due to Confidential s frequent company acquisition.
  • Redesigned the data persistence and the web service layers to support multiple data sources.
  • Redeveloped the data persistence and the web service layers
  • Consolidated the methods in different layers with max reuse of the existing ones and min modifications in UI.

Confidential, Chantilly, VA

Sr. Software Architect

Responsibilities:

  • Full life cycle software development on Management Console (MC) using Java, C/C++, JNI, Java ServletsJSP, Swing, Jigloo, XSLT, XML, JDOM, AJAX, Struts, Hibernate, PostGreSQL 8.1, Tomcat, JUnit, Ht tpUnit, AntSVN, Viso, Log4j, Araxis Merge, Agile, JProfiler, Rainbow iKey 1000, # LF MS Visual Studio .NET 2003, Cygwin, Tera Term Pro, VMWare, etc.
  • Architect, Design and Develop the Management Console for VPN secure networks
  • MC Settings Configure Management Console System settings
  • Configure Certificate Authority Settings
  • User and Role Managements
  • Certificate Services o Generate new signing certificates PKCS12 o Define Red and Green Lists by importing different template and data files
  • Audit Management Configuration and Audit Events
  • MC Backup and Restore/Upgrade
  • Device Management Management of both logical and physical VPN devices
  • Reporting o MC system report o Remote access connection report o Remote access RemoteLink connection report o Red List report
  • Confidential Token Package Download
  • Performance Tuning
  • TM
  • Architect, Design and Develop the RemoteLink
  • Token Utility burn and read the iKeys using Java, Swing, JNI, C/C++, Rainbow iKey C APIsNetwork programming, secure communicate (https), etc.
  • Bug Fixing

Confidential, Arlington, VA

Sr. Software Architect & Manager of Engineering

Responsibilities:

  • Mentor Junior to Senior - level staff on Java, J2EE, Design strategy and sk ills, etc
  • Full life cycle software development on RAHS (Risk Assessment and Horizon Scanning) using Java, Eclipse RCPSOA architecture, Web Services, JAX-RPC, XML, JBoss 3.2.5, Oracle 9i, Eclipse 3.1.2, etc.
  • Architect and Design the Collaboration Framework
  • The Chat functionality
  • The Event Service Synchronous and Asynchronous Notification Framework
  • The Synchronization Engine
  • Data Modeling
  • Architect, Design and Develop a Web Service Fa ade.
  • Partition application into subsystems
  • Determine the way for the Eclipse plug-ins to share the JAX-RPC stub.
  • Implement the drag and drop functionality using Eclipse RCP.
  • Manage both the local team and the Outsourcing Team.
  • Conduct Project Scope and Management.
  • Full life cycle software development on DIANE (DIgital ANalysis Environment) using Java, Java Portlets (JSR 168)Weblogic JSP Portlets, Web Services, Java Servlets, JSP, XSLT, XML, JDBC, EJB, JMS, Weblogic Server 8.1.4Weblogic Studio 8.1.4, Struts 1.1, Hibernate, Oracle 9i, SOA, DashO 3.2, JUnit, HttpUnit, Ant, CVS, Viso, Log4jAraxis Merge, Agile, JProfiler, etc. # LF
  • Migrate DIANE from JBoss 3.2 to Weblogic Server 8.1.4 with lots of Weblogic server configurations, JAAS security components modification and configuration, etc.
  • Lead the architectural improvements to the core DIANE product.
  • Provide guidance and direction to ensure the integration of the individual applications
  • Refactory DIANE Java/J2EE components.
  • Design a new architecture for DIANE using Java Portles, Web services, etc. and develop necessary architectural documentation to communicate DIANE functionality to two target audiences: technical & business.
  • Make DIANE Portletized Modify DIANE web application into a Weblogic Portal Application using Weblogic
  • JSP portlets, Java Portlets (JSR 168), Java Servlets, Web services, etc.
  • Lead/Mentor development team to bring DIANE unit tests up to speed.
  • Research & Investigate new capabilities and improvements to the DIANE platform.
  • Facilitate management ability to increase (and track) team productivity using the Agile development methodology.
  • Be hands - on lead for and provide inputs on various requests from the technical team.
  • Manage the development status for the team members.

Confidential, Reston, VA

Sr. Software Architect/Developer, Team Lead

Responsibilities:

  • Mentor Junior to Senior - level staff on Java, J2EE, Design strategy and sk ills, etc
  • Full life cycle software development on new features of the Fusion Server using Java, EJB, JDO RMI, XML SchemaJDBC, JMS, Weblogic 7/8.1, WebSphere 5.1, JBoss 3.0, Oracle, SQL Server, JUnit, Ant, CVS, Viso, BugTrackLog4j, #LF Enterprise Designer, UNIX, Hummingbird, Araxis Merge, Borland Optimizeit Enterprise Suite, etc.
  • Architect, design and develop the integration of PiiE Fusion Server with SAP system via Librados JCA framework.
  • Architect, design and develop the integration of PiiE Fusion Server with Web Services
  • Architect, design and develop the integration of PiiE Fusion Server with various external JMS servers
  • (SonicMQ, MQSerious, JBossMQ, etc.)
  • Modify, improve and document the architecture of the PiiE Fusion Server.
  • Lead the architecture and design reviews on the integration of PiiE Fusion Server wi th SAP, Web Services and external JMS servers.
  • Provide guidance and direction to ensure the integration of the individual applications
  • Partition application into subsystems
  • Remote Admin & Startup using Java Servlet, JSP, etc.
  • Migrate EJBs from Weblogic 7/8 to WhereSphere 5.1 save() transactional: architect, design and develop the transaction feature of PiiE Fusion Server
  • Admin Restarter Service (RMI)
  • Create JDBC connection pool for performance tuning
  • J2EE Exception handling
  • Create External Relationship Table as a new feature of the Fusion server
  • Code Coverage Analysis
  • Various bug fixing

Confidential, Reston, VA

Sr. J2EE Developer/Architect, Team Lead

Responsibilities:

  • Mentor Junior to Senior - level staff on Java, J2EE, Design strategy and sk ills, etc
  • Full life cycle (requirement, design, development, deployment, testing & maintenance) of Multi -tier Distributed
  • Programming using EJB, Java Servlet, JSP, XML, JDBC2.0, JMS, JavaMail, UML, Oracle stored procedureWeblogic application server, Weblogic Personalization Server, Rational Rose, Rational RequisitePro, #LF Rational
  • ClearCase, VisualCaf, JBuilder, DreamWeaver, SQL Navigator, Rational ClearQuest, log4j, Ant, MS
  • SourceSafe, SonicMQ, JavaScript, DHTML, etc ;
  • Confidential Enterprise Messenger and Broadcast
  • Architect, Design and Develop the following projects using Weblogic 7.0 Application ServerEJBs(Stateless session, Message-Driven), Servlet, JSP, XML, Oracle Stored procedure, JavaScriptDHTML, # LF log4j, etc.

We'd love your feedback!